Pretty interesting pre-DSOTM versions of the songs from that album. Us and Them is cut short. It sounds like the first LP has speed issues (either when it was recorded or when it was pressed). There are some highlights (On the Run is very cool, Money was pretty good), but overall I do not think the performance of the DSOTM material was that good.The second LP had great versions all around and the band sounded really good. Echoes fades out (tape change?) If for no other reasons, I would say get it for the second LP. The DSOTM stuff is somewhat unmemorable.
